To get the Greates Common Factor (GCF) of 798 and 2090 we need to factor each value first and then we choose all the copies of factors and multiply them:

798:   23 7 19
2090:   2 5 1119
GCF:   2    19

The Greates Common Factor (GCF) is:   2 x 19 = 38
